2017-08-11 65 views
0

我想創建一個重定向到新站點,除了一個節點和2個文件夾。重定向到除1個節點之外的新站點

的文件夾1和文件夾2的例外是工作好,但不適合「節點路徑」

<IfModule mod_rewrite.c> 
    RewriteEngine On 
    RewriteCond $1 !^folder1 
    RewriteCond $1 !^folder2 
    RewriteCond $1 !^/node-path 
    RewriteRule (.*) http://www.newsite.com [R=301,L] 
</IfModule> 

回答

0

變化與/node-path到該行:

RewriteCond $1 !^node-path 

在htaccess的,沒有/在RewriteRule測試網址的開頭。

您可以在一個與測試所有:

RewriteCond $1 !^(?:node-path|folder1|folder2) 
+0

沒有,沒有工作 – jimi

+0

你有沒有清除緩存或者使用其他瀏覽器試試?舉一個使用/ node-path的例子(www.domain.com/node-path?) – Croises

+0

是的,我清除了緩存。它是一個drupal節點,也許這是原因? – jimi

相關問題